EACTS reconnects in Barcelona 2021 was a year for reconnecting as the world came to terms with the Covid pandemic that had disrupted so much of 2020. In fact, ‘reconnecting’ was the theme of the 35th EACTS Annual Meeting in Barcelona in October. As one of the first major gatherings in the field of professional medicine, it was a chance for cardiothoracic surgeons to meet face-to-face once again, to seek out old friends, to establish new links, and to find out what everybody else has been working on.
What they found in the science and education programme did not disappoint. The mix of presentations, focus sessions, handson tutorials, training simulations and expert discussions was as intense, invigorating and innovative as ever. It set an incredibly high standard for the 36th EACTS Annual Meeting which will be in Milan next October – a date for the diary. The EACTS Annual Meeting is also the traditional time of change in the organisation. As usual, the most visible display of this was the handover of the Presidential chain from Mark Hazekamp to Friedhelm Beyersdorf.
